What is an explosion proof high bay light?

An explosion proof high bay light is an industrial LED fixture designed for hazardous areas where flammable gases, vapors, dust, or harsh operating conditions may exist. It is used in high-ceiling spaces such as oil & gas plants, chemical facilities, marine sites, and industrial warehouses.

What certifications should buyers check before choosing explosion proof high bay lighting?

Buyers should check whether the fixture matches the site’s hazardous area classification. FY product pages reference certifications and ratings such as UL, UL 844, IP66, IK10, Class I Division 2, Class II Division 2, and Class III for certain configurations.

Why is IP66 protection important for explosion proof high bay lights?

IP66 protection helps protect the fixture against dust and powerful water jets. This is important for hazardous industrial sites where fixtures may face washdown, moisture, dust, or outdoor exposure.
